Rosemary cuttings: how to reproduce this plant

Aromatics as a general rule we will try cuttings after summer floweringso by my standards and all the times I’ve tried and succeeded, the best time to do this is autumn. That’s not to say it can’t be done year-round, but in my experience it has always been the most successful time to make rosemary or other aromatic cuttings.

Propagate rosemary by cuttings

We will make rosemary cuttings with a semi-woody branch, that is, from the second year. As I said before, the best time is fall, although late summer can also be useful.

We will cut about 15 to 20 cm, but no more to prevent it from having trouble rooting. We make a diagonal cut and we will put it in rooting overnight. As you will see in the video, you can both put the branch with the leaves down and remove it. In both cases, we could have the same results.

Once this is done, the next day we will throw away the rooting agent or use it to water another plant, and leave our cuttings in the water. If we want to root again with the same cuttings, we will do it after 7 days, not before. Once in the water, we will leave it next to the window, in an area that is not too cold, in order to obtain better results.

From 3 weeks the rosemary will begin to take root, with which we can transplant it into a first container or pot, not exceeding 15 centimeters in height. We are going to prepare this pot with a substrate that mixes soil with earthworm humus. We make a hole, place the rosemary cutting, taking care not to damage the root and gently cover. We water it every other day with rooting, but keep in mind that it doesn’t like excess moisture.
